  • “Public Toilets are a basic human right”: Calls to reopen Cardiff's conveniences

    By Nia George Verified| cardiffjournalism.co.uk@ Only 28% of Council-operated toilets in Cardiff are open for public use, making lockdown even harder on the tens of thousands of people who suffer with bowel and bladder conditions. One of the few things people can do in lockdown is outdoor exercise, but some people face being prevented from even that enjoyment by the lack of facilities. At the beginning of lockdown all Cardiff Council’s toilets were closed to the public to help prevent transmission of Covid-19.

ITV plc is a prominent British media company and the main operator of the ITV Network, the UK's oldest commercial terrestrial television network. Established on February 2, 2004, through the merger of regional licensees, ITV holds 13 of the 15 regional ITV licenses and is headquartered in London. The company is publicly traded on the London Stock Exchange and is part of the FTSE 250 Index. ITV operates as a vertically integrated producer-broadcaster and streaming service provider, divided into two main divisions: Media & Entertainment and ITV Studios. The Media & Entertainment division manages ITV's broadcast channels and digital platforms, including the ad-supported streaming service ITVX. ITV Studios produces a wide range of content, including popular shows like *Love Island* and *The Voice UK*, and distributes programming globally. ITV serves over 30 million monthly users and partners with advertisers and broadcasters to monetize its extensive audience reach.
